Abstract

A modular electric connector comprises a module piece, an insulating body, a plurality of conductive terminals and a metal shell, wherein the module piece is combined with the insulating body, and the metal shell is sleeved on the periphery of the module piece. Therefore, the module part can be matched with the design of the metal shell, the insulating body and the conductive terminals can be manufactured in advance, and the conductive terminals are embedded and formed in the insulating body, so that the yield can be increased.

背景技术 Background technique

一般如个人计算机、电视屏幕等电子产品,多半会于机壳内部设置插座电连接器,以与外围的设备作一信号的传递。Generally, electronic products such as personal computers, TV screens, etc., most of them will be equipped with socket electrical connectors inside the casings to transmit signals with peripheral devices.

请参阅图1,一般电连接器100a的制作是先制作一绝缘本体110a,该绝缘本体110a内设有多个槽孔111a,然后将多个导电端子120a,以穿设的方式设置于该绝缘本体110a内,最后再将绝缘本体110a设置于一金属壳体130a内。Please refer to FIG. 1 , the production of the general electrical connector 100a is to first produce an insulating body 110a, the insulating body 110a is provided with a plurality of slots 111a, and then a plurality of conductive terminals 120a are arranged on the insulating body 110a in a penetrating manner. In the main body 110a, the insulating main body 110a is finally arranged in a metal shell 130a.

然而,于该等导电端子120a穿设于槽孔111a内时,若导电端子120a的其中一个约略不平整,则会穿设失败,将导致整个电连接器110a成为不良品,因此增加成本。However, when the conductive terminals 120a are inserted into the slots 111a, if one of the conductive terminals 120a is slightly uneven, the insertion will fail, and the entire electrical connector 110a will become a defective product, thus increasing the cost.

另外,金属壳体130a时常会依据不同的设计或是规格,而有不同的结构,此时若该金属壳体130a的设计突然变更,则已经制作完成的绝缘本体110a与金属壳体130a则需废弃。另外,整个绝缘本体110a需重新开模,进而增加制作费用。In addition, the metal shell 130a often has different structures according to different designs or specifications. At this time, if the design of the metal shell 130a suddenly changes, the completed insulating body 110a and the metal shell 130a need to be replaced. abandoned. In addition, the entire insulating body 110a needs to be molded again, which further increases the production cost.

因此,本实用新型的主要目的在于提供一种模块式电连接器,以改善上述问题。Therefore, the main purpose of the present invention is to provide a modular electrical connector to improve the above problems.

实用新型内容 Utility model content

本实用新型的目的在提供一种模块式电连接器,其具有一模块件与绝缘本体组合,该模块件可依据不同的金属壳体而有不同的设计,另外导电端子亦埋入成型于该绝缘本体,如此可避免现有导电端子穿设于绝缘本体时可能造成的损坏。The purpose of this utility model is to provide a modular electrical connector, which has a combination of a modular part and an insulating body. The modular part can have different designs according to different metal shells. In addition, the conductive terminals are also embedded and formed in the The insulating body, in this way, can avoid the possible damage caused when the existing conductive terminals pass through the insulating body.

为了达到上述的目的,本实用新型提供一种模块式电连接器,包含一模块件、一绝缘本体、多个导电端子、及一金属壳体。In order to achieve the above purpose, the utility model provides a modular electrical connector, which includes a module, an insulating body, a plurality of conductive terminals, and a metal shell.

该模块件具有沿一组合方向沿伸的一前端面与一相对于该前端面的后端面、及与该前端面和该后端面相连的一底面,该底面邻近于该前端面处向内凹陷形成一组合槽,该前端面设有一开口与该组合槽相连通。The module part has a front end surface extending along a combination direction, a rear end surface opposite to the front end surface, and a bottom surface connected to the front end surface and the rear end surface, and the bottom surface is recessed inwardly adjacent to the front end surface A combination groove is formed, and an opening is provided on the front end to communicate with the combination groove.

该绝缘本体包含一基部与一舌板。该基部组合于该组合槽内,该舌板自该基部向一延伸方向延伸。The insulating body includes a base and a tongue. The base is combined in the combination groove, and the tongue extends from the base to an extending direction.

每一导电端子包含一接触部与一倾斜部。该接触部埋入成型于该舌板。该倾斜部由该接触部的一端沿一倾斜方向倾斜延伸而出。该金属壳体组设于该模块件的外围。Each conductive terminal includes a contact portion and an inclined portion. The contact portion is embedded in the tongue plate. The inclined portion obliquely extends from one end of the contact portion along an inclined direction. The metal shell is assembled on the periphery of the module.

因此,本实用新型可由一模块件与绝缘本体组合,使该模块件可依据金属壳体不同的设计而变更,如此可防止该金属壳体的突然变更,而使得绝缘本体与导电端子结合的半成品报废。另外该绝缘本体与导电端子可以预先制作完成,因此可加快电连接器的制作速度。Therefore, the utility model can be combined with a module part and the insulating body, so that the module part can be changed according to different designs of the metal shell, so that the sudden change of the metal shell can be prevented, and the semi-finished product combined with the insulating body and the conductive terminal can be prevented. scrapped. In addition, the insulating body and the conductive terminals can be pre-fabricated, thus speeding up the manufacturing speed of the electrical connector.

本实用新型的导电端子亦以埋入成型的方式埋设于该绝缘本体内,因此可解决现有以导电端子穿设于绝缘本体时穿设失败,而造成报废的问题。The conductive terminal of the present invention is also buried in the insulating body by embedding molding, so it can solve the problem that the conventional conductive terminal fails to be inserted in the insulating body and causes scrapping.

本实用新型的模块式电连接器的制作与组装方式,描述于后。请参阅图5,为本实用新型的端子板件600的上视图,本实用新型的导电端子400可由端子板件600冲压、裁切及折弯而制成。端子板件600包含该等导电端子400、连接板件610、620。连接板件610、620设置于导电端子400的两端。The manufacturing and assembling methods of the modular electrical connector of the present invention are described below. Please refer to FIG. 5 , which is a top view of the terminal plate 600 of the present invention. The conductive terminal 400 of the present invention can be made by stamping, cutting and bending the terminal plate 600 . The terminal board 600 includes the conductive terminals 400 and connecting boards 610 , 620 . The connecting plates 610 , 620 are disposed at two ends of the conductive terminal 400 .

请参阅图6,其中绝缘本体200与定位件300以埋入成型的方式直接成型于端子板件600上,并于成型后将将端子板件600进行裁切,而仅留下导电端子400与连接板件620相连。为了能使绝缘本体200于成型时彼此间不至于相连,连接板件610、620需设有一最小宽度h1。由于本实用新型采取模块件100与绝缘本体200组合的方式,而绝缘本体200的宽度小于模块件100,因此连接板件610、620的最小宽度可以较小,进而能节省材料费。Please refer to FIG. 6 , wherein the insulating body 200 and the positioning member 300 are directly molded on the terminal plate 600 by embedded molding, and the terminal plate 600 will be cut after molding, leaving only the conductive terminals 400 and The connection boards 620 are connected. In order to prevent the insulating body 200 from being connected to each other during molding, the connecting plate parts 610 and 620 need to be provided with a minimum width h1. Since the present invention combines the module 100 with the insulating body 200, and the width of the insulating body 200 is smaller than the module 100, the minimum width of the connecting plates 610, 620 can be smaller, thereby saving material costs.

请参阅图7,模块件100与绝缘本体200的组合动作图,其中导电端子400尚未弯折,并与连接板件620相连。模块件100沿组合方向D1下压,使基部容置于模块件100的组合槽107(如图4所示),并可一并将导电端子400的倾斜部420与安装部430弯折。Please refer to FIG. 7 , which is a combination operation diagram of the module part 100 and the insulating body 200 , wherein the conductive terminal 400 has not been bent yet and is connected to the connecting plate part 620 . The module 100 is pressed down along the assembly direction D1 so that the base is accommodated in the assembly groove 107 of the module 100 (as shown in FIG. 4 ), and the inclined portion 420 and the mounting portion 430 of the conductive terminal 400 can be bent together.

最后再将与导电端子400相连的连接板件620裁切,以形成图8的最后成品。此时该导电端子400的倾斜部420受到模块件100的压制,而该使得该倾斜部420施于该模块件100一残存应力,能使得该倾斜部420贴合于该模块件100,使得该等导电端子400间能够保持齐平。Finally, the connecting plate 620 connected with the conductive terminal 400 is cut to form the final product of FIG. 8 . At this time, the inclined portion 420 of the conductive terminal 400 is pressed by the module 100, and the inclined portion 420 exerts a residual stress on the module 100, so that the inclined portion 420 is attached to the module 100, so that the The conductive terminals 400 can be kept flush.

当定位件300及/或绝缘本体200(如图2所示),埋入成型于导电端子400时,再裁切掉连接板件610、620,以确保导电端子400间的对齐及平整性。When the positioning member 300 and/or the insulating body 200 (as shown in FIG. 2 ) is embedded in the conductive terminal 400 , the connecting plate parts 610 and 620 are cut off to ensure the alignment and flatness of the conductive terminals 400 .
